1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S PURPOSE:
To determine the proportion of material of each grain size present in a given soil (grain-size distribution)
3
1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S USES: Soil Classification according to USCS.
The distibution of different grain sizes affects the engineering properties of soil. Assesment of hydraulic permeability (Understanding of the movement of the water through soil gaps).

1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S SEIVE ANALYSIS Sieving Procedure
(επιλογή κοσκίνων – ASTM D 421 – 85) (επιλογή κοσκίνων – ASTM D 421 – 85) (επιλογή κοσκίνων – ASTM D 421 – 85) Sieving Procedure Select a series of sieves with openings ranging from 3 in. to mm (No. 200). The number and sizes of sieves used for testing a given soil will depend on the range of soil sizes in the material. Weight them empty. The size of the sample to be used will depend on the maximum particle size in the sample and the requirement that the sample be representative of the material to be tested. The sample should be limited in weight so that no sieve in the series will be overloaded. Oven-dry the sample at ii0 f 5 C, allow to cool, and weigh.. Place the nest of sieves in the shaking machine and shake them for 3 to 5 min, more or less.

Operational principle
1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S HYDROMETER ANALYSIS Operational principle The hydrometer method of analysis is based on Stokes’ law, which relates the terminal velocity of a sphere falling freely through a fluid to the diameter. The hydrometer determines the percentage of dispersed soil particles remaining in suspension at a given time. It consists of a cylindrical stem and a bulb weighted with mercury or lead shot to make it float upright. Hydrometer, calibrated at 20/20 C (68/68 F), graduated in specific gravity or grams per liter

1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S HYDROMETER ANALYSIS Procedure
(ASTM D 421 – 85) Procedure Collect the dried soil from 50gr up to 100gr. ( Material is taken from the bottom pan ). Put the soil in a beaker containing a solution of 125 ml with distilled water and dispersing agent . Transfer the soil-water slurry to the mechanical stirrer and stir for 15 min. If necessary add water. Transfer the suspension into a 1000-ml sedimentation cylinder and add distilled or demineralized water until the volume of the suspension equals 1000 ml. Observe and record the hydrometer readings on the data sheet after 1 and 2 min have elapsed from the time the cylinder is placed on the table

1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S HYDROMETER ANALYSIS COMPUTATIONS
Meniscus Correction. (Ractual) Hydrometers are calibrated to read correctly at the surface of the liquid. Soil suspensions are not transparent and a reading at the surface is not possible; therefore, the hydrometer reading must be made at the upper rim of the meniscus.

1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S COMBINED ANALYSIS
Includes sieve analysis and hydrometer analysis. When a combination of the results is done we must take into account the proportions of the grains both in sieves and in hydrometer. We adapt the hydrometer percent finer to the total Passing from sieve Νr 200

Characteristic values
1. GRAIN SIZE ANALYSIS Characteristic values Diameter D50 : corresponds to 50% of the passing soil. It informs us about the middle grain size that characterizes our sample Diameter D10 : corresponds to 10% of the passing soil. It is connected to the permeability of the soil. Uniformity coefficient (Cu) Cu=D60 / D10 If Cu< 5 the soil is uniform. If Cu> 15 the soil is well gradated
